As Mumbai local train service resumes, social distancing goes off track Pankaj Upadhyay Mumbai's local trains, considered the lifeline for commuters in the city, resumed operations with restricted timings from February 1. Ever since the local train services resumed in the city, Covid-19 restrictions like social distancing and mask-wearing have gone for a toss. The precautionary measures are not being strictly followed either at the platform ticket counters or at the platforms. Many commuters seem to be under the impression that the worst is past them.
